Released February 23rd, 2024, 'Drive-Away Dolls' stars Margaret Qualley, Geraldine Viswanathan, Beanie Feldstein, Joey Slotnick The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 24 min, and received a user score of 56 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 175 well-known users.
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Jamie, an uninhibited free spirit bemoaning yet another breakup with a girlfriend, and her demure friend Marian desperately needs to loosen up. In search of a fresh start, the two embark on an impromptu road trip to Tallahassee, but things quickly go awry when they cross paths with a group of inept criminals along the way."
'Drive-Away Dolls' is currently available to rent, purchase, or stream via subscription on Apple iTunes, YouTube, Google Play Movies, Amazon Video, Vudu, and Peacock .
